Summary
This is an educational announcement for an in-person training program on abuse, neglect, and exploitation (ANE) prevention and response for intermediate care facility staff in Galveston, Texas on July 7, 2026. The training offers continuing education credits for nurses, social workers, administrators, and nurse aides but does not impose new billing, coding, or coverage requirements.
